The "work" they have put in justifies them charging full-price, it doesn't have to have anything to do with engine limitations. They can put the work in that ads on VR support to a game they have already made but spin it around and charge it full price because the market will support that. If they just glommed on VR support to Fallout 4 then it would have to compete with that, be attached to that and everything that comes with it. A new game means a new, blank store front, news feed, marketing angle and news coverage separate from everything Fallout 4 already has.
The trick is though they did just glom on VR support to Fallout 4 but are going to way that makes them the most money.

The differences between them doing the Skyrim Special Edition thing and Fallout 4 VR are pretty wide with what we know. Skyrim Special Edition is different from Oldrim in that SSE is on the Fallout 4 engine, a x64 executable and all the changes that come with that which is the reason mods don't just 'work' without a minimum of conversion. The only issue I can see with mods on Fallout 4 VR is performance destruction because modders have no checks when it comes to framerates. 4k textures for spoons are the norm you see.
